Note on procurement integrity

Gov1.com and GrantFinder are compliant with federal standards and guidance for working with organizations seeking grant dollars. All assistance is category and non-product specific. Gov1.com and GrantFinder do not benefit from, participate in, or otherwise influence the procurement of awards. All assistance is product- and vendor-neutral to avoid any real or apparent conflict of interest. Organizations receiving support are responsible for maintaining a conflict of interest policy in compliance with federal guidelines (e.g. 2 CFR Part 200), including maintaining adequate supporting documentation.
